Construction Co. Urges Court To Ax Labor Deal Requirements
By Madeline Lyskawa ( September 26, 2025, 9:18 PM EDT) -- A construction company called on the U.S. Court of Federal Claims to order the Army Corps of Engineers to eliminate requirements that companies negotiate labor prices and work terms with a labor union to be eligible for a construction contract....
